My grandma used to make this every Christmas and Thanksgiving. I made it for the first time for Thanksgiving this year, and it was a big hit. However, I omit the mayo. It's not as shiny looking or as rich without it, but it is also lighter, fluffier, and slightly sweeter. I also double the whipped cream and use one 8 oz. can of whole berry and one 8 oz. can of jellied cranberry sauce.

Delicious and very pretty for holiday table. I added a can of mandarin oranges and pineapple tidbits which I had drained for 12 hours and a cup of marshmallows. Next time will reduce conf. sugar, as it was quite sweet.
